Adjusting their environment and lifestyle can significantly impact their recovery and overall well-being. This article explores how reducing exposure to environmental toxins, increasing physical activity, and minimizing stress can contribute to a healthier, more supportive environment for dogs battling cancer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Reducing Exposure to Environmental Toxins<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>One of the most crucial steps in supporting a dog with cancer is minimizing their exposure to harmful chemicals and toxins. Here\u2019s how you can create a cleaner, safer living environment for your pet: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Avoid Chemical Cleaners<\/strong>: Switch to natural, non-toxic cleaning products in your home. Chemical cleaners can release harmful fumes and residues that your dog might inhale or ingest. Opt for eco-friendly alternatives that are safe for both pets and humans.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Limit Pesticide Exposure<\/strong>: Keep your dog away from areas that have been treated with pesticides or herbicides. These chemicals can be harmful, especially to dogs with compromised immune systems. Consider using natural pest control methods in your garden or yard.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Choose Safe Pet Products<\/strong>: Be mindful of the products you use on your dog, such as shampoos, flea treatments, and grooming products. Select items that are free from harsh chemicals and are specifically formulated for pets with sensitive health needs.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Increasing Exercise and Activity<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Physical activity is vital for maintaining your dog\u2019s health, especially during cancer treatment. Regular exercise offers numerous benefits: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Boosting Immunity<\/strong>: Exercise helps to strengthen your dog\u2019s immune system, making them more resilient against illness. Even light activity, like walking or gentle play, can have a positive impact on their health.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Enhancing Physical Strength<\/strong>: Maintaining physical strength is important for dogs undergoing cancer treatment. Exercise helps to preserve muscle mass, improve circulation, and support overall vitality.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Improving Mental Health<\/strong>: Regular activity can alleviate symptoms of depression or anxiety in dogs, providing them with mental stimulation and a sense of normalcy. This is especially important during the stress of treatment.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Minimizing Stress for Better Recovery<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Creating a low-stress environment is essential for dogs dealing with cancer. Stress can negatively affect their immune system and slow down recovery. Here are some strategies to help keep your dog calm and relaxed: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Provide Consistent Routine<\/strong>: Dogs thrive on routine. Maintaining a consistent daily schedule for feeding, walks, and rest helps reduce anxiety and provides a sense of stability.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Incorporate Relaxation Techniques<\/strong>: Regularly petting, gentle brushing, and massage can help your dog relax and reduce stress. These activities not only soothe your dog but also strengthen your bond with them.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Create a Peaceful Environment<\/strong>: Ensure your dog has a quiet, comfortable space where they can rest undisturbed. This environment should be free from loud noises, excessive foot traffic, and other stressors.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<p>Supporting a dog through cancer treatment involves more than just medical care. By reducing exposure to environmental toxins, increasing exercise, and minimizing stress, you can create a healthier and more nurturing environment that promotes recovery and well-being. These lifestyle adjustments can make a significant difference in your dog\u2019s quality of life during this challenging time.<\/p>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Caring for a dog undergoing cancer treatment involves more than just medical interventions.
